Cooling off and dealing with your anger
Here are some ways cool off or chill out when you feel you are too angry to control what you say or do:
Take a walk
Write about your anger
Talk to a friend
Count to 10
Create some art
Meditate
Play golf
Listen to music (music is tricky because music that "pumps"
  you up or has violence-promoting words, can work against
  your cooling down efforts)
Write your own music, or poetry
Run or jog
Exercise (exercise is tricky too, you have to know yourself
  really well. If you get "pumped up" and feel "big and bad" after
  exercises like kickboxing or punching a bag, these kinds of
  exercise can work against you.)
Go somewhere private where no one can hear you and yell out
  loud
